Typical vehicle options for local group travel
Vehicle Typical capacity Best for
Charter coach 40–60 passengers Large school trips, corporate events, long-distance charters
Minibus 15–30 passengers Local shuttles, small groups, shorter day trips
Luxury Sprinter / Shuttle 8–14 passengers Private tours, executive travel, wedding parties
Limo / Sedan 2–6 passengers Airport runs, VIP transfers, driver‑led sedans
